{"data":{"id":"us/10-cfr-53.400","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"10 CFR 53.400","heading":"Design features for licensing-basis events.","body":"(a) Design features must be provided for each commercial nuclear plant such that, when combined with corresponding human actions and programmatic controls, the plant will satisfy the safety criteria defined in §§ 53.210 and 53.220.\n(b) Design features must ensure that the safety functions identified in § 53.230 are fulfilled during licensing-basis events (LBEs).","path":["Title 10—Energy","CHAPTER I—NUCLEAR REGULATORY COMMISSION","PART 53—RISK-INFORMED, TECHNOLOGY-INCLUSIVE REGULATORY FRAMEWORK FOR COMMERCIAL NUCLEAR PLANTS","Subpart C—Design and Analysis Requirements"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-10.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:24:09Z","sha256":"343939d3a40da1f94621b905046b3b9049fb3a5f89cbdb147d32429e7a91ef9f","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/10-cfr-53.270","next":"us/10-cfr-53.410"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
